Iris Pro Graphics P580
The Iris Pro Graphics P580 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in September 1 2015. It features the Generation 9.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 350 MHz to 1050 MHz. It has 576 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 15W. Manufactured using 14 nm+ process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 2,026 points.

Iris Plus Graphics G7 (Ice Lake 64 EU)
The Iris Plus Graphics G7 (Ice Lake 64 EU) is manufactured by Intel. It was released in May 28 2019. It features the Gen. 11 Ice Lake architecture. The core clock ranges from 300 MHz to 1100 MHz. It has 64 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 12W. Manufactured using 10 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 2,000 points.
Graphics Performance
The Iris Pro Graphics P580 scores 2,026 and the Iris Plus Graphics G7 (Ice Lake 64 EU) reaches 2,000 in the G3D Mark benchmark — just a 1.3% difference, making them near-identical in rasterization performance. The Iris Pro Graphics P580 is built on Generation 9.0 while the Iris Plus Graphics G7 (Ice Lake 64 EU) uses Gen. 11 Ice Lake, both on 14 nm+ vs 10 nm. Shader units: 576 (Iris Pro Graphics P580) vs 64 (Iris Plus Graphics G7 (Ice Lake 64 EU)). Boost clocks: 1050 MHz vs 1100 MHz.
